Jammu-Srinagar Vande Bharat Gets Third Train: Route, Stops & Latest Update

Jammu-Srinagar Vande Bharat Express: Indian Railways is set to expand services on the Jammu-Srinagar corridor with a third Vande Bharat Express, offering passengers another fast and modern travel option between Jammu and Kashmir.

The new service has been approved to operate between Jammu Tawi and Srinagar via Udhampur, with Udhampur being included as a stop on the new service. The development comes amid strong demand for Vande Bharat trains connecting Jammu with the Kashmir Valley.

Third Vande Bharat Train Approved for Jammu-Srinagar Route

The Railway Ministry has approved a third Vande Bharat Express between Jammu Tawi and Srinagar. The new service will operate as Train No. 26407/26408 and will travel via Martyr Captain Tushar Mahajan Udhampur.

The announcement was shared by Union Minister Dr Jitendra Singh on August 20, 2026, following approval from Railway Minister Ashwini Vaishnaw. The additional service is expected to improve connectivity and provide more travel options for passengers travelling between Jammu and Srinagar.

Jammu-Srinagar Vande Bharat Route

The existing Jammu-Srinagar Vande Bharat services cover approximately 269 km and take around 4 hours 45 minutes. The route passes through the dramatic Himalayan landscape and some of the most significant railway infrastructure in Jammu and Kashmir.

The new Vande Bharat will follow the Jammu-Srinagar corridor with Udhampur included as a stop.

Expected Route and Major Stops

The Jammu-Srinagar Vande Bharat corridor includes:

  • Jammu Tawi

  • Martyr Captain Tushar Mahajan Udhampur

  • Shri Mata Vaishno Devi Katra

  • Reasi

  • Banihal

  • Srinagar

The four existing en-route stoppages are Martyr Captain Tushar Mahajan, Shri Mata Vaishno Devi Katra, Reasi and Banihal. The third service specifically adds Udhampur as a stop, responding to demand from the local population.

Jammu-Srinagar Vande Bharat Already Has Two Services

The Jammu-Srinagar corridor currently has two Vande Bharat train pairs, operating four services between Jammu and Srinagar.

The trains were initially introduced between Shri Mata Vaishno Devi Katra and Srinagar on June 6, 2025. From April 30, 2026, the services were extended to Jammu Tawi, providing a direct passenger rail connection between Jammu and Srinagar.

The existing services operate as 26401/26402 and 26404/26403.

Vande Bharat Capacity Increased to 20 Coaches

The growing popularity of the Jammu-Srinagar Vande Bharat has already led Indian Railways to increase the train's capacity.

In April 2026, the service was expanded from 8 coaches to 20 coaches and extended from Katra to Jammu Tawi. The Railway Ministry said the expansion was intended to meet rising passenger demand.

The services have seen strong passenger demand since their introduction, with the Railways reporting high occupancy from the beginning of operations.

A Scenic Journey Through the Himalayas

One of the biggest attractions of the Jammu-Srinagar Vande Bharat route is the journey itself.

The train travels through the Udhampur-Srinagar-Baramulla Rail Link (USBRL), crossing tunnels, bridges and spectacular Himalayan terrain. Among the most iconic structures along the corridor is the Chenab Rail Bridge, one of the world's most remarkable railway engineering projects.

The route also features the Anji Khad Bridge, another major engineering landmark on the USBRL corridor. Railway authorities have highlighted the importance of the corridor in strengthening all-weather connectivity between Jammu and the Kashmir Valley.

Why the Third Vande Bharat Is Important

The introduction of another Jammu-Srinagar Vande Bharat could benefit several categories of travellers.

More Travel Options

An additional service can provide passengers with greater flexibility when planning journeys between Jammu and Srinagar.

Better Connectivity for Udhampur

The inclusion of Udhampur as a stop is particularly significant for residents and travellers from the area, giving them direct access to the Vande Bharat service.

Boost to Kashmir Tourism

Improved rail connectivity can make Kashmir more accessible to domestic tourists, particularly during busy travel seasons.

Easier Pilgrimage Travel

The route also serves Shri Mata Vaishno Devi Katra, making the service useful for pilgrims travelling between Jammu, Katra and the Kashmir Valley.

Stronger Regional Connectivity

The Jammu-Srinagar railway corridor is expected to support tourism, local businesses and the movement of people and goods across Jammu and Kashmir. The Railway Ministry has described improved rail connectivity as an important contributor to tourism and regional economic activity.
